Python Intern (Ai-Driven Recruitment Automation)

Details of the offer

Python Intern (AI-Driven Recruitment Automation) Company:  M365Connect Location:  Remote Duration:  3 months (with potential for extension) Commitment:  Full-time, 40 hours per week About M365Connect M365Connect is an innovative IT recruitment company based in Latvia, specializing in connecting top-tier Microsoft professionals with leading tech organizations.
Leveraging advanced tools like  Manatal  (our Applicant Tracking System), we aim to redefine recruitment processes with technology.
As part of our mission, we are implementing an  AI-powered automation solution  to streamline how applications are reviewed and shortlisting decisions are made.
Position Overview We are looking for a  Python Intern  to develop and implement a solution that integrates  Manatals API  with a  Large Language Model (LLM)  to automate the evaluation of incoming job applications.
The project involves building a system that triggers workflows whenever a new application is received, evaluates the match between the candidates profile and the job requirements, and executes decisions (e.g., scheduling interviews or rejecting candidates) via the Manatal API.
This internship offers hands-on experience with real-world AI and automation challenges and provides the opportunity to leave a tangible impact on the recruitment industry.
A  certificate of completion  will be issued upon successful and exemplary completion of the internship.
What You'll Do Analyze our current manual shortlisting process within  Manatal  and design an automation workflow.
Read and understand the  Manatal API  documentation.
( https://support.manatal.com/docs/manatal-api ) Propose a detailed  approach and technical stack  for implementing the solution, which includes: An explanation of how the LLM will evaluate candidates based on resumes and job descriptions.
Steps for integrating the LLM with the Manatal API.
How automation workflows will be triggered and executed.
Develop and maintain the codebase using  GitHub .
Create a system where every time a new application is received, the workflow is triggered, evaluates the application against the job criteria using the LLM, and performs actions (e.g., inviting the candidate for an interview or declining the application).
Collaborate with the recruitment and technical teams to ensure the solution is accurate, fair, and scalable.
Document the process and provide a clear explanation of each development step and decision.
Present the proposed approach in an  interview , including a short explanation or  presentation upfront  before development begins.
Who You Are Education:  Recent graduate in  Computer Science ,  Data Science ,  AI , or a related field.
Skills: Proficient in  Python , with experience in libraries like  NumPy ,  Pandas ,  Scikit-learn , or  TensorFlow .
Comfortable working with  APIs  and integrating third-party services (experience with  Manatal API  is a bonus).
Familiar with  GitHub  for version control and collaborative development.
Passionate about  AI, automation, and NLP , with an eagerness to tackle complex business problems.
Strong analytical and communication skills, with the ability to present technical concepts clearly.
Available for  40 hours per week  during the internship.
Bonus Skills (Not Required, but a Plus) Hands-on experience with  NLP models  (e.g., transformers or other frameworks for text analysis).
Familiarity with  cloud deployment  (e.g., Docker, AWS, Azure).
Previous experience in  HR tech  or recruitment workflows.
What We Offer Real-world experience  with a project that transforms the recruitment industry.
Exposure to cutting-edge  AI and NLP technologies .
A structured and supportive environment, including mentorship from experienced engineers.
Flexibility to work  remotely  while collaborating with a dynamic team.
A  certificate of completion  for successful interns, showcasing their contributions and achievements.
Monthly  Wi-Fi expense coverage .
Valuable experience in  AI and recruitment automation , enhancing your career prospects.
How to Apply Please submit the following: Your CV A  brief cover letter  addressing the following: Why are you excited about this project and AI-driven recruitment automation?
Your relevant coursework or experience with Python, AI, or NLP.
A high-level explanation of your  approach and technical stack  for integrating the Manatal API with an LLM to automate the shortlisting process.
We look forward to hearing from talented individuals ready to tackle this exciting challenge.
Apply today and join M365Connect in  revolutionizing recruitment with AI !


Nominal Salary: To be agreed

Source: Talent_Ppc

Requirements

Senior Data Engineer At Ezra

About the Role The Senior Data Engineer will be reporting to the Data Engineering Team Lead. Key Role Responsibilities Developing data processing pipelines P...


Ezra - Nairobi Area

Published a month ago

Senior Software Engineer In Test: Qa Engineer At Cellulant Corporation

JOB DESCRIPTION: As a Software Quality Test Engineer, you will utilize your experience and technical expertise to make your mark in our software development'...


Ion - Nairobi Area

Published a month ago

Senior Engineer-Platform Engineering At Ezra

Context of the role In this role you will be responsible for designing, implementing, and deployment and maintainance of Ezra Platforms which encompasses the...


Ezra - Nairobi Area

Published a month ago

Senior Retool Software Engineer At Jumia

What you will be doing Autonomy interpreting business/technical requirements, designing, implementing, and testing high-quality solutions Work in a team-base...


Jumia - Nairobi Area

Published a month ago

Built at: 2024-12-03T18:57:27.285Z